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Big-eared Flying Fox | pineapple scale |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Hemiptera (Hemiptera) |
| Family | Pteropodidae (Fruit Bats) | Diaspididae |
| Genus | Pteropus (Flying Foxes) | Diaspis |
| Species | Pteropus macrotis | Diaspis bromeliae |
Evolutionary Relationship
Big-eared Flying Fox and pineapple scale share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
